Rachel Ball Ware 1732–1800 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1732
Birth Location: Watertown, Middlesex County, Massachusetts, United States of America
Death Date: 11 June 1800
Death Location: Wrentham, Norfolk County, Massachusetts, United States of America
Father: Josiah Stearns
Mother: Dorothy Prentice
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
In 1732, Rachel Ball Ware entered the world in Watertown, Middlesex County, Massachusetts, United States of America, born to Josiah Stearns And Dorothy Prentice. Rachel Ball Ware passed away in 1800 in Wrentham, Norfolk County, Massachusetts, United States of America.
